Even without a power-play goal, the Devils generated momentum early.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Within just a few seconds of our first power play, Nico rips one off the post,\u201d Keefe said. \u201cWe had a couple great saves (against us) right after that. That gives the team confidence offensively, and I think that transfers into the five-on-five play too.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Jesper Bratt echoed that sentiment, pointing to the two days between games as a reset.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e had a little bit more of a meeting to refocus and try to find our identity again,\u201d Bratt said. \u201cThe way the game started in Vegas, first shift, getting thrown into the fire right away, that was good for us.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Identity Over Outcomes<\/p>\n<p>For Bratt, the biggest takeaway from Vegas wasn\u2019t what went on the scoresheet, but how the Devils played.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I think the power play was good as well and pretty much did everything without scoring,\u201d he said. \u201cIt\u2019s our reads, being aggressive, the other guys reading off what the first guy\u2019s doing. If he\u2019s pressuring, then everyone else is joining.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>That aggression has also carried over to the penalty kill.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Our swagger on the PK, even on the bench, it\u2019s like, \u2018Guys, we\u2019ll get this done and create momentum and then we\u2019ll go to work,\u2019\u201d Bratt said.<\/p>\n<p>Keefe agreed that those details have been missing at times.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In terms of striking early, being organized, solving pressure, winning face-offs, it hasn\u2019t quite been there for us,\u201d he said. \u201cSo I loved how we dug in, won the face-off, were able to strike right away and get the puck back. That\u2019s what you want your power play to look like.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The challenge now is consistency.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ve been doing a pretty good job,\u201d Bratt said, \u201cbut the challenge for us has been to do it over and over again and not take a step back. Today\u2019s the perfect test after the type of game we played in Vegas.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Managing the Middle of the Ice<\/p>\n<p>Against a Utah team that ranks among the league leaders in shot differential and thrives on quick transitions, the neutral zone looms large.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e want to be in and out of our zone quickly, through the neutral zone,\u201d Keefe said. \u201cWhen we do that, we\u2019re able to tilt the ice and get our forechecking game going or even a rush game if you catch them in between.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Bratt pointed to improved structure from the forwards as a key factor.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ve been talking a lot about having that guy close to the battle but also being ready to skate back the other way,\u201d he said. \u201cStripping pucks in the neutral zone to transition and go the other way. Last game in Vegas, we had a good identity with that.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Keefe noted there\u2019s still work to do.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If there was one area we want to clean up from Vegas, it\u2019s that we lost our (high forward) a few times,\u201d he said. \u201cBut for the most part, we\u2019ve done a good job of being above the threat and killing plays early.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Ready for the Test<\/p>\n<p>Utah presents a different challenge than Vegas, but one the Devils believe fits their focus on habits and detail.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This is a team that forechecks well, is dangerous on the rush, and defends through the neutral zone very well,\u201d Keefe said. \u201cManaging that area of the game is going to be important for us.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>For Bratt, the circumstances are familiar.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ve dealt with this in the past where guys are hurt and the guys in the room have to get the job done,\u201d he said. \u201cIt\u2019s just about not taking a step back.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The team held an optional skate after a late and lengthy practice yesterday afternoon.
